PSM2 is the only valid implementation for OmniPath (OPA). UCX also supports OmniPath, but it does so via Verbs, thus getting much lower performance (typically 3 GiB/s instead of 10 GiB/s). To work around that, give the mtl_psm2 component a higher priority than the pml_ucx component.
